ARCHIVE_WRITE_DATA(3)    BSD Library Functions Manual    ARCHIVE_WRITE_DATA(3)

NAME
     archive_write_data, archive_write_data_block — functions for creating ar-
     chives

LIBRARY
     Streaming Archive Library (libarchive, -larchive)

SYNOPSIS
     #include <archive.h>

     la_ssize_t
     archive_write_data(struct archive *, const void *, size_t);

     la_ssize_t
     archive_write_data_block(struct archive *, const void *, size_t size,
         int64_t offset);

DESCRIPTION
     archive_write_data()
             Write data corresponding to the header just written.

     archive_write_data_block()
             Write data corresponding to the header just written.  This is
             like archive_write_data() except that it performs a seek on the
             file being written to the specified offset before writing the
             data.  This is useful when restoring sparse files from archive
             formats that support sparse files.  Returns number of bytes writ-
             ten or -1 on error.  (Note: This is currently not supported for
             archive_write handles, only for archive_write_disk handles.

RETURN VALUES
     This function returns the number of bytes actually written, or a negative
     error code on error.

ERRORS
     Detailed error codes and textual descriptions are available from the
     archive_errno() and archive_error_string() functions.

BUGS
     In libarchive 3.x, this function sometimes returns zero on success in-
     stead of returning the number of bytes written.  Specifically, this oc-
     curs when writing to an archive_write_disk handle.  Clients should treat
     any value less than zero as an error and consider any non-negative value
     as success.
